1. Optimize Your Profile One Section at a Time
Think of your profile like your digital handshake—it speaks before you do. You don’t have to overhaul it all at once. Each week, give 5 minutes to one section: maybe it’s refreshing your headline with powerful, clarity-driven language (tip: not just job titles—think results, stories, or transformations), or lining up your skills with what you’re growing into, not just what you’ve done.
Use statements like “Helping mindful brands scale with soul” or “Leadership coach guiding teams through emotional resilience” to add texture to your title. That’s the voice employers, collaborators, and kindred spirits will feel instantly.
2. Engage With Intention, Not Just Activity
We often think visibility means shouting into the void. In reality, the most respected LinkedIn thought leaders connect by listening first. Once a week, spend 7–8 minutes reading and commenting meaningfully on posts that align with what you care about. Don’t just react—respond thoughtfully. Support a colleague’s pivot, add insight to a wellness topic, or share a quick story that adds depth.
This simple action signals your mindset, values, and energy—and powerful people notice thoughtful presence.
3. Post From Your Heart, Not Just Your Hustle
Even one post a month can transform how others see you—and how you see yourself. If you’ve grown, learned, failed forward, celebrated quietly, or embraced change in your business or personal journey, LinkedIn welcomes that kind of realness. A 5-minute voice note turned into a few sentences can become your next post—use bullet points, a short story, or a reflection.
Example: “Last week, I spoke up in a meeting for the first time after always holding back. It had me thinking about how many of us wait to feel ‘ready’ instead of realizing we already are. What’s one moment you’ve surprised yourself lately?” This sparks engagement rooted in connection.
4. Check In With Your Network—Directly
In just 2–3 minutes, pick one person in your LinkedIn list and drop them a genuine message. No pitch, no pressure. Just: “Hey, I saw your post about [topic]—it really resonated. Would love to connect deeper when you’re open.” One message a week builds a web of shared values and mutual uplift.
